Buying Guide: Choosing The Right Melitta Brewer

The following considerations can help match a Melitta brewer to user needs across capacity, material, and workflow preferences.

  • Brewing Method: Decide between manual pour-over and automatic drip. Pour-over models give control over pour rate and bloom; programmable drip machines add convenience and scheduling.
  • Capacity: Match carafe size to household or office use. Options shown range from single-cup or six-cup sets to 10-cup and 12-cup models.
  • Carafe Material: Glass carafes are visually clear and allow pouring tracking; thermal stainless carafes retain heat longer without a hot plate; porcelain maintains temperature and aesthetics but is heavier.
  • Filter Compatibility: Melitta models typically call for specific cone sizes (#4 or #6). Confirm filter availability and cost for long-term use.
  • Extraction Control: Manual pour-over allows technique-driven extraction control. Automatic models with aroma or strength settings offer electronic control over flavor concentration.
  • Maintenance & Durability: Check whether cones are dishwasher safe and the durability of plastic vs. porcelain components. Stainless steel carafes resist staining and thermal shock.
  • Temperature Stability: Thermal carafes and porcelain maintain higher brewing or holding temperatures than thin glass without a heated plate.
  • Portability & Sharing: For office sharing, a larger thermal carafe or 12-cup programmable brewer may be preferable. For single-serve or travel, compact pour-over cones fit better.
  • Noise & Automation: Manual pour-over is silent and hands-on; programmable drip models may have pump or element sounds and provide scheduled brewing.
  • Extraction Goals: If clarity and single-cup precision are priorities, choose pour-over. If consistency, automation, and volume matter more, choose programmable drip models with strength controls.

Comparative perspective: pour-over sets emphasize flavor nuance and user technique, thermal and porcelain carafes emphasize heat retention and presentation, while programmable drip units emphasize convenience and repeatability. Match the model to your priorities for volume, control, and post-brew temperature management.
